Here, we successfully reproduce the experimental observation of the photoinduced CDW transition on the In / Si (111) … Beginning in the late 1970s, Peter Goldreich, Frank Shu, and others applied density wave theory to the rings of Saturn. Saturn's rings (particularly the A Ring) contain a great many spiral density waves and spiral bending waves excited by Lindblad resonances and vertical resonances (respectively) with Saturn's moons. The physics are largely the same as with galaxies, though spiral waves in Saturn's rings are much more tightly wound (extending a few hundred kilometer…

WebThe most accepted explanation for the occurrence of the dynamic type of instabilities is called density wave oscillations (DWO). The density wave causes a delay in the local pressure drop caused by a change in inlet flow. Because of this delay, the sum of all local pressure drops may result in a total drop that is out-of-phase with the inlet ...
